About This Color

PANTONE 61-1-7 C is a desaturated blue with medium tonality. Its HEX value is #43558B, placing it in the blue region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 225°.

This mid-range tone offers excellent versatility, working in both digital interfaces and print applications. It provides strong visual impact while maintaining readability when paired with light or dark text.
